OMNA BCAST Identification Authority Registry

OMNA maintains this registry for Identification Authority associated with BCAST services.

The Identification Authority label follow a simple naming model that permits unambiguous usage. Each Identification Authority label is structured as a URN to assure uniqueness. The model follows the following grammar:

{IdentAuthLabel} ::= urn:oma:bcast:iauth:{IAiD}

Where:

- {IAiD} is a string that is registered to a BCAST Identification Authority (see table below)

Notes:

1. {IAiD} patterns starting with 'x-' are for testing and need not be coordinated with OMNA as they will not be recorded
2. {IAiD} patterns starting with 'dns-' are an alternative to registration when the text following the 'dns-' is a legitimate domain name string. As an alternative to registration, such strings need not be requested by OMNA, nor will they be recorded.

For more information, please review Appendix H of OMA-TS-BCAST_ServiceGuide-V1_0.
